Extended Look at Super Mario 3D World + Bowser’s Fury Gameplay and More

By Keith MitchellJanuary 13, 2021
Super Mario 3D World + Bowser's Fury, Bowser's Fury

Yesterday, Nintendo finally gave the world a look at the upcoming Super Mario 3d World + Bowser’s Fury. Today, the company has released an overview of what we can expect in the upcoming title, and I have to admit that the game is looking to 1Up the original game from the Nintendo Wii U. It also doesn’t hurt that this is the best 3D Super Mario title, and I’ll fight you over that.

In this new video, we’re shown a nice bit of gameplay. The new snapshot photo mode lets us take in-game pics, online and co-op modes, and confirmation of a playable Bowser Jr. Yep, you heard me, Bowser Jr. is playable but only for a secondary player.

This video clocks in at 7-minutes; it’s like a Nintendo Mini-direct. I was already hyped to replay this game since it has been confined on the Wii U, and I got rid of mine a long time ago, so it’s kind of impossible to replay it. With this trailer’s release, I can’t wait to dive back into the game.

Super Mario 3D World + Bowser’s Fury releases on February 12th, 2021, on the Nintendo Switch.
